What Is Apple Cider Vinegar?
Apple cider vinegar (ACV) is crafted through the fermentation of apple juice, resulting in a nutrient-rich liquid packed with acetic acid, enzymes, and probiotics. For generations, it has been valued as a versatile natural remedy, known to support skin, hair, digestion—and even nail health!

How to Use Apple Cider Vinegar for Nails at Home
There are several simple yet effective ways to incorporate Apple Cider Vinegar for Nails into your daily or weekly nail routine. Always choose raw, unfiltered ACV, it gives you best results.

1. ACV Soak for Nail Fungus & Strengthening
Ingredients:
1-part raw apple cider vinegar
1-part warm water
A small bowl
Instructions:
Add water with ACV and both should be same amount.
Soak your nails for 15–20 minutes daily.
Rinse and pat dry thoroughly.
Repeat daily for 2 weeks for best results.
Tip: Add a few drops of tea tree oil for extra antifungal action.

3. Overnight Nail Strengthener

Ingredients:
1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
1 tablespoon olive oil
Instructions:
Mix both in a small bowl.
Massage the mixture into your nails and cuticles.
Wear cotton gloves and leave overnight.
Repeat twice a week for healthier nails.

Precautions When Using Apple Cider Vinegar for Nails
While Apple Cider Vinegar for Nails is natural and safe, keep these precautions in mind:
make it thin: otherwise, it may irritate your sensitive skin
Avoid open wounds: Do not apply if you have cuts or open hangnails.
Moisturize after use: Always follow with a natural oil or hand cream to prevent dryness.
